What type of reaction is it when one of more atoms replace one other atom or group of atoms in a molecule?

The reaction in which one or more atoms replace another atom or group of atoms in a molecule is called a substitution reaction. This type of reaction is common in organic chemistry and can involve various mechanisms, such as nucleophilic substitution or electrophilic substitution. During this process, the original atom or group is displaced, leading to the formation of a new compound.
